  • Topical 0.05% Clobetasol Propionate versus 1% pimecrolimus ointment in vitiligo
    European Journal of Dermatology, 2005
    Co-Authors: Basak Kandi Coskun, Yunus Saral, Dilara Turgut
    Abstract:

    Vitiligo is a common skin condition resulting from loss of normal melanin pigments in the skin which produces white patches. Topical corticosteroids are indicated for the treatment of limited areas of vitiligo. Pimecrolimus, which inhibits calcineurin, has recently been shown to be effective for the treatment of vitiligo. We performed a prospective study to evaluate the efficacy of the 0.05% Clobetasol Propionate and 1% pimecrolimus in the treatment of vitiligo. Ten patients with virtually bilateral symmetrical lesions of vitiligo were included. 0.05% Clobetasol Propionate was applied twice daily over the lesion on right side of the body, and topical 1% pimecrolimus was applied twice daily over the lesion on left side of the body. It was determined that both treatment modalities resulted in a comparable rate of repigmentation. Response to treatment was varied according to the anatomical location of the lesions where better results were seen on the trunk and extremities. Results from this pilot study indicate that topical 1% pimecrolimus is as effective as Clobetasol Propionate in restoring skin disfiguring due to vitiligo. For a better conclusive statement further studies involving larger groups of patients should be performed.

  • Clobetasol Propionate for psoriasis are ointments really more potent
    Journal of Drugs in Dermatology, 2006
    Co-Authors: Lindsey Warino, Rajesh Balkrishnan, Steven R Feldman
    Abstract:

    BACKGROUND: Clobetasol Propionate is the most common topical therapy used for psoriasis in the US. Conventional dermatologic wisdom is that ointment preparations provide the highest potency (due to their occlusive nature and moisturizing ability) and are best suited for psoriasis. However, patients often find application of ointment to be messy, raising concerns about both short-term and long-term adherence to treatment. This article reviews the current literature and assesses the relative potency of Clobetasol Propionate ointment compared to other Clobetasol Propionate preparations in the treatment of psoriasis. Relevant literature was identified by PubMed and Google searches. We included studies of psoriasis that reported the percentage of subjects that achieved desired efficacy endpoints, as well as studies that reported the subjects' mean change in symptoms from baseline. We excluded studies conducted before 1980 and those that allowed concomitant treatments. OBSERVATIONS: Efficacy rates ranged from 17% to 80% for the different vehicles: ointment, solution, foam, cream, lotion, shampoo, and emollient. CONCLUSIONS: Clobetasol Propionate is a very effective treatment for psoriasis. Ointment preparations have similar efficacy to other preparations in clinical trial situations. In clinical practice, a situation in which patient preferences are more likely to affect compliance, it may be best to choose whichever vehicle patients find preferable.

  • The use of 0.25% zinc pyrithione spray does not enhance the efficacy of Clobetasol Propionate 0.05% foam in the treatment of psoriasis.
    Journal of The American Academy of Dermatology, 2003
    Co-Authors: Tamara Salam Housman, Alan B Fleischer, Kimberly A. Keil, Beverly G. Mellen, Martha Ann Mccarty, Steven R Feldman
    Abstract:

    Abstract Background: It was discovered that Skin Cap (Cheminova Internacional S.A., Madrid, Spain), an over-the-counter psoriasis therapy with zinc pyrithione, contained Clobetasol Propionate and it was withdrawn from the market by the US Food and Drug Administration review. Some suggested that there might be a synergistic effect of zinc pyrithione with Clobetasol Propionate. Objective: We sought to evaluate the efficacy of Clobetasol Propionate 0.05% foam with and without the coadministration of a topical 0.25% zinc pyrithione spray in treating psoriasis involving sites other than the scalp. Methods: We conducted a randomized, double-blind, right/left study of patients with mild to moderate, generally symmetric, plaque-type psoriasis. Patients were assigned to treatment with Clobetasol Propionate foam on all psoriatic lesions and then randomly assigned to use zinc pyrithione spray to either the right or left side of their body (vehicle spray to be applied to the opposite side). There was a 2-week treatment phase (visits at baseline, week 1, and week 2) and a follow-up phase (visit at week 4), and all treatments were administered twice daily for 2 weeks. The primary outcome measure was the change from baseline to week 2 in the composite score of the signs of psoriasis (erythema, scaling, plaque thickness) for symmetric target lesions. Results: A total of 25 patients were enrolled; 24 completed the trial and 1 was lost to follow up. Of those who completed the study, 63% (15 of 24) were men, and the mean age (±SD) was 50 years (±12.2). After 2 weeks of therapy, the average decline in the composite score was 3.5 (±1.8) for monotherapy (Clobetasol Propionate foam and vehicle) and, similarly, 3.3 (±1.8) for Clobetasol Propionate foam plus zinc pyrithione spray ( P = .5). Discussion: Zinc pyrithione spray does not appear to enhance the efficacy of Clobetasol Propionate foam after 2 weeks of therapy. (J Am Acad Dermatol 2003;49:79-82.)

  • Clobetasol Propionate 0.05% under occlusion in the treatment of alopecia totalis/universalis.
    Journal of The American Academy of Dermatology, 2003
    Co-Authors: Antonella Tosti, Bianca Maria Piraccini, Massimiliano Pazzaglia, Colombina Vincenzi
    Abstract:

    Abstract Background: Efficacy of topical steroids in alopecia areata is still discussed. Objective: The purpose of this study was to evaluate the efficacy of Clobetasol Propionate 0.05% ointment under occlusion in 28 patients with alopecia areata totalis (AT) or AT/alopecia universalis. Methods: A total of 28 patients were instructed to apply 2.5 g of Clobetasol Propionate to the right side of the scalp every night under occlusion with a plastic film. Treatment was performed 6 days a week for 6 months. When regrowth of terminal hair occurred, treatment was extended over the entire scalp. All patients were followed up for another 6 months. Results: Of the 28 patients included in the study, 8 were treated successfully (28.5%). Regrowth of terminal hair began on the treated side 6 to 14 weeks after the start of treatment. Of these 8 patients, 3 had a relapse and were not able to maintain hair regrowth. Conclusion: Our study shows that Clobetasol Propionate 0.05% under occlusion is effective in inducing hair regrowth in patients with AT or AT/alopecia universalis. Occurrence of hair regrowth only on the treated half of the scalp clearly shows that efficacy of treatment is a result of a local and not systemic effect of the drug. Although only 17.8% of patients had long-term benefit by treatment, our results were obtained in a population of patients with severe and refractory forms of the disease. (J Am Acad Dermatol 2003;49:96-8.)
